Waitrose Again Takes ‘Most Compassionate Supermarket’
November 28, 2005
Demonstrating excellence in criteria such as “stocking densities, freedom to express natural behaviour and the overall well being of animals,” Waitrose held on to the Most Compassionate Supermarket title again this year, as awarded by Compassion in World Farming (CIWF).
